Introduction to Cancun, Mexico

Cancun is a beautiful city located on the eastern coast of Mexico's Yucatan Peninsula in the state of Quintana Roo. The city is renowned for its stunning beaches, turquoise waters, and vibrant nightlife. It is a popular destination for tourists from all over the world who come to enjoy the warm weather, sandy beaches, and the many attractions the city has to offer.

Cancun was originally a small fishing village, but it has transformed into a bustling city with a thriving tourism industry. It is now home to some of the most luxurious hotels and resorts in the world, offering visitors a plethora of options for accommodations.

Aside from its beautiful beaches, Cancun also has a rich cultural heritage that is worth exploring. The city is home to several ancient Mayan ruins, such as the famous Chichen Itza, which is one of the Seven Wonders of the World.

Cancun is also famous for its delicious cuisine, which features a blend of traditional Mexican flavors and international influences. Visitors can enjoy a variety of local dishes, including tacos, ceviche, and guacamole, as well as a range of international cuisines.

Top Attractions in Cancun, Mexico

Cancun, Mexico is a destination that offers a perfect mix of natural beauty, cultural heritage, and modern amenities. From the pristine beaches to the bustling nightlife, Cancun has something to offer for everyone. Here are some of the top attractions in Cancun that you should not miss:

Chichen Itza: Chichen Itza is one of the most popular archaeological sites in the world, located about two hours away from Cancun. This ancient city was once the center of the Mayan civilization and is home to numerous temples, pyramids, and other structures that offer a glimpse into the rich cultural heritage of the region.

Tulum: Tulum is a small coastal town located about an hour and a half away from Cancun. It is home to some of the most beautiful beaches in the world, as well as a well-preserved Mayan archaeological site that offers a glimpse into the ancient civilization that once thrived in the region.

Xcaret Park: Xcaret Park is a popular eco-archaeological park that offers a range of activities, from snorkeling and swimming with dolphins to exploring underground rivers and caves. It is also home to a wildlife sanctuary that includes jaguars, monkeys, and other exotic animals.

Isla Mujeres: Isla Mujeres is a small island located just off the coast of Cancun. It is known for its crystal-clear waters, pristine beaches, and vibrant coral reefs that offer some of the best snorkeling and diving opportunities in the world.

Cancun Underwater Museum: The Cancun Underwater Museum is a unique attraction that features a collection of over 500 life-size sculptures that have been submerged in the waters off the coast of Cancun. It offers a one-of-a-kind experience for divers and snorkelers who want to explore the stunning underwater world.

Best Areas to Stay in Cancun, Mexico

Cancun, Mexico is a popular destination for tourists from all over the world. With its beautiful beaches, crystal clear waters, and vibrant nightlife, it's no wonder why so many people choose to visit this tropical paradise. But with so many areas to choose from, it can be difficult to know which one is the best fit for your needs. In this article, we'll take a closer look at some of the best areas to stay in Cancun, Mexico.

Hotel Zone

The Hotel Zone is the most popular area for tourists in Cancun. Located on a narrow strip of land between the Caribbean Sea and the Nichupté Lagoon, this area is home to some of the most luxurious hotels, resorts, and restaurants in the city. The beaches in the Hotel Zone are some of the most beautiful in the world, with soft white sand and crystal clear water. The nightlife in this area is also legendary, with a wide variety of bars, clubs, and entertainment options to choose from.

Downtown Cancun

Downtown Cancun is the heart of the city and is a great place to stay if you want to experience the local culture. This area is home to many of the city's best restaurants, shops, and markets, as well as historic landmarks and museums. It's also one of the most affordable areas to stay in Cancun, with many budget-friendly hotels and hostels.

Puerto Juarez

If you're looking for a quieter, more relaxed atmosphere, Puerto Juarez is a great option. This area is located on the northern edge of Cancun and is known for its beautiful beaches, calm waters, and stunning sunsets. There are also many great seafood restaurants in Puerto Juarez, as well as a ferry terminal where you can catch a boat to Isla Mujeres.

Playa Mujeres

Located just north of the Hotel Zone, Playa Mujeres is a newer area that's quickly becoming popular with tourists. This area is home to some of the most luxurious resorts in Cancun, as well as a beautiful golf course and marina. The beaches in Playa Mujeres are also some of the best in the city, with soft white sand and clear blue water.

Isla Mujeres

If you're looking for a true escape from the hustle and bustle of Cancun, Isla Mujeres is a great option. This small island is located just a short ferry ride from Puerto Juarez and is known for its pristine beaches, crystal clear water, and laid-back atmosphere. There are also many great restaurants and bars on the island, as well as a variety of water activities to choose from.

Getting Around in Cancun, Mexico

Getting Around in Cancun, Mexico

Cancun is a vibrant city located on the northeast coast of the Yucatan Peninsula in Mexico. It is known for its stunning beaches, turquoise waters, and rich cultural history. To fully explore this beautiful city, visitors need to know how to get around. In this section, we will explore the various modes of transportation available to tourists in Cancun.

Taxis

Taxis are a common mode of transportation in Cancun. They are readily available and can be hailed from the street or ordered through the hotel. Taxis are affordable, and the rates are regulated by the government. They provide a comfortable and convenient way to travel around the city. However, tourists should always ensure that they negotiate the fare before getting into the taxi to avoid overcharging.

Buses

Buses are the cheapest way to get around Cancun. The local buses are called “Ruta” and are easily identifiable by their blue and white color. The buses run on fixed routes and are very frequent. They are an excellent way to explore the city and get a feel for the local culture. However, the buses can be crowded and uncomfortable during peak hours.

Car Rental

Car rental is an ideal option for tourists who want to explore Cancun at their leisure. There are many car rental companies in Cancun, and tourists can rent a car for a day or a week. Renting a car provides the flexibility to visit the various attractions at your own pace. However, tourists should be aware that driving in Cancun can be chaotic, and the roads can be confusing.

Bicycle Rental

Bicycle rental is a popular option among tourists in Cancun. It is an eco-friendly and healthy way to explore the city. There are many bicycle rental shops in Cancun, and tourists can rent a bicycle for a few hours or a day. However, tourists should be aware that cycling in Cancun can be challenging, especially during peak traffic hours.

Walking

Walking is the best way to explore the downtown area of Cancun. The city is pedestrian-friendly, and there are many sidewalks and pedestrian crossings. Walking provides an opportunity to soak in the local culture and observe the daily life of the people of Cancun. However, tourists should be aware that walking during the day can be hot and humid.
